[16-Aug-10][KBS]Powerful Team Heads Drama The Fugitive: Plan B
The director Kwak Jung Hwan and the writer Chun Sung Il, who had set the country on fire in the first half of this year with the drama The Slave Hunters, have formed a production team again in the second half. The KBS 2TV drama The Fugitive: Plan B, which will begin airing from the end of September, is the drama that they will work on together.
A romantic comedy and action drama, The Fugitive: Plan B will tell a story of an astronomical amount of money which had disappeared during the Korean War and resurfaced some sixty years later in 2010, and it will film dynamic and realistic chase scenes in overseas locations in Asian countries such as Seoul, Busan, Tokyo, Osaka, Yokohama, Shanghai, Beijing, Macao, and Hong Kong.
The drama has attracted great interest not only for its production team, but also because of its cast members including Rain (Jung Ji Hoon) and Lee Na Young, and become the most anticipated drama for the second half of 2010. The following are the main cast members of the drama.

Rain (Jung Ji Hoon), who created a sensation by having been cast as the protagonist of the drama, will play the character Ji Woo, who has fluid physical movements and a positive personality. In the drama, he will be challenged by becoming involved in an unfinished case to solve, and he will star alongside actress Lee Na Young.
Actress Lee Na Young will make a comeback with this drama after a six-year break, and will play mysterious character Jin Yi, who will show off a beauty characterized by purity and sexiness at the same time. In the drama, she will approach Ji Woo intentionally to get information about the case and end up taking on the case together with Ji Woo. She will also present a unique romance.
Lee Jung Jin will play the section chief of a foreign affairs investigation in the police station named Do Soo who will chase Ji Woo and Jin Yi while they are engaged in the mystery incident. He will play a character who continuously desires and takes actions to succeed in the social structure. In particular, he is drawing anticipation from viewers as his character will confront Ji Woo in a showdown.

Daniel Henney, who was chosen as a top "hot guy" in a survey conducted in Hollywood and has been attracting female fans worldwide by showing off his gentle yet muscular charm, will play a shipping magnate named Kai who loves Jin Yi (Lee Na Young) and is fated to confront Rain.
Yoon Jin Seo has shown totally different images by appearing in different works. She transformed into a married woman who was pretending to be naïve and having an affair with another man in the movie A Good Day to Have an Affair, and an innocent high school student in the movie Someone Behind You, and she also played the double role of Wol Hee, whom Iljimae loved for his lifetime, and Dal Hee in the drama The Return of Iljimae. In this drama, she will play a detective surnamed Yoon who belongs to a foreign affairs investigation at a police headquarters, and she will chase Rain and Lee Na Young.
Hallyu star Yoon Sohn Ha, who has gained huge popularity in Japan, will cast off her innocent and pure image and transform into a femme fatale character, and will confront Rain and Lee Na Young.
# Three best supporting actors in the drama The Slave Hunters - Sung Dong Il, Kong Hyung Jin, and Cho Hee Bong
The best supporting actors who played the characters Chun Ji Ho,Yupbongi, and Kketbongi in the drama The Slave Hunters and made viewers laugh and cry, will appear in this drama again as cast members. Sung Dong Il will play a Korean-Japanese character who is the most clever private investigator in Japan named Nakamura Hwang. Kong Hyung Jin will portray Ji Woo (Rain)s supporter named Master Jang, and Cho Hee Bong will play a cold blooded private detective based in Vietnam and Thailand whose name is James. Their appearance in the drama is expected to create a synergistic effect in the drama for their acting ability, making people laugh, and being indispensable characters in the drama by delivering ad libs.

In Fugitive, not only star Korean actors, but also star actors from Japan and Hong Kong will appear as cast members.
Japanese actor, director and comedian Naoto Takenaka, who has many fans in Korea with his impressive acting in the movies such as Shall We Dance and Water Boys, and in the drama Nodame Cantabile, will join as a cast member, and he will play the character Hiroki, who governs the Japanese politics and economy during the day and dominates the Yakuza world at night.
In addition, an original Japanese idol group member who has broken a record regarding the youngest age in the Japanese pop music industry, and who has gained huge popularity as a famous beautiful actress in Japan, Uehara Takako, has been cast as a cast member, and she will present a tragic love with Ji Woo in the drama.
Hong Kongs national actor and film director Eric Tsang will make a guest appearance as a friend of Ji Woo and a business partner of Kai named General Wi. In particular, he has become a hot topic as he delivered his intention to work for free, saying, I want to appear in the drama even without payment, after he expressed interest in the fact that the drama will be filmed in different cities in Asian countries.
Those wishing to get a chance to see the best and most famous actors from home and abroad all together at the same time, and the opportunity to see different cities in Asian countries while watching exciting chase scenes, will be satisfied with the unique romantic comedy and action drama The Fugitive: Plan B, which is being made by a proven writer, director, and production staff team. The extravagant opening episode will be aired at the end of September on KBS 2TV.
